LUCKNOW, May 26 -- A group of armed assailants travelling in four SUVs opened indiscriminate fire, pumping three bullets into a hotelier-cum-property dealer and critically injuring him over a personal dispute in the state capital's Sarvodaya Nagar area on Sunday evening.
ADCP East Pankaj Singh confirmed that CCTV footage is being reviewed and efforts are on to identify and arrest the suspects. Ghazipur police are working on tracking the assailants based on the vehicles' movement and registration details.
The incident took place after the attackers had clashed earlier in the day with the victim identified as Mursaleen (35), originally from Kursi in Barabanki, over food at a local hotel, according to the police.
